Recently, one of the two 1200t wind power installation platforms built by CSSC as general contractor successfully debuted and the other one delivered. Among them, HXFL Shenda 01 completed the installation of a 14.3 MW wind turbine, and HXFL Shenda 02 was delivered early.

The 1200t wind power installation platform is a new generation self-elevating model with advanced technologies for self-elevation, lifting and wind turbine installation for leading lifting capacity, efficiency, integration, mobility, operation stability and survivability.

The 14.3mw wind turbine is the debut of HXFL Shenda 01 at Liu'ao offshore wind farm, solving storage, assembly and hoisting problems of large megawatt wind turbines on complex sea areas, with strong stability and high-precision positioning of 4G wind power installation platform.

Through enhanced production and process control after launch to water, HXFL Shenda 02 project achieved early delivery with major tasks completed in 3 months including main and auxiliary crane installation, pile leg connection, mooring tests, sea trials and full stroke lifting.
